Job Description - Heavy Duty Mechanic

Looking for a fast paced, ever changing, dynamic work place?  Love living in the Okanagan, having your weekends off? Enjoy working on a variety of equipment from 5500 to 50 ton tri drives?  We may be the place for you. We are expanding again and we are looking for a experienced HD tech who can has hydraulic, wiring, and light fabrication experience to help us maintain our fleet of 100plus pieces. 



What the job entails:



Job Duties:s



  • Perform diagnostics, pre- inspections, and troubleshoot all our light duty to heavy-duty trucks and trailers.

  • Conduct repairs and preventative maintenance on engines, brakes, electrical systems, hydraulic, and other mechanical components.

  • Ensure all work is completed according to manufacturer specifications and safety standards.

  • Work well and fit in with our existing team members to solve complex mechanical issues.

  • Assist with parts ordering and inventory management as needed.

  • Adhere to all safety protocols and company policies.



What you bring to the table:



Required Skills and Qualifications:



  • Red Seal certification or equivalent in Heavy Duty Mechanic/Truck & Transport Technician, will look at someone with the right mix of knowledge and experience 

  • Experience welding and light fabrication, wiring and hydraulics both on trucks and trailers

  • Strong diagnostic and troubleshooting skills for mechanical, electrical, and hydraulic systems

  • Experience using different diagnostic tools and techniques

  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ment

  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ality

  • Excellent time management and organizational skills

  • Knowledge of safety procedures and adherence to safety standards
